There's another reason why this is such a special issue for me: I have an article published in this issue about art notes -- illustrator's statements about the media and/or technique used in the creation of the artwork.  Being an illustrator and a librarian I've always been interested in the media used in picture books.  I wrote a piece about it, submitted to the Horn Book and it was accepted.  It is a true honor for me to be part of such a distinguished magazine about children's literature!

Here's an example of an art note from the adorable Here Comes the Easter Cat by Deborah Underwood, illustrated by Claudia Rueda:


"The art was made with ink and color pencils on white paper, surrounded by hundreds of cats (ink cats!)

Art notes come in all different formats -- some very short, some very detailed, some with a touch of humor (a favorite of mine!), but they're not always present.  This was a fun article to write so it's great to see it in print.
